prophet:Automatic Forecasting Procedure
Implements a procedure for forecasting time series data based on an additive model where non-linear trends are fit with yearly, weekly, and daily seasonality, plus holiday effects. It works best with time series that have strong seasonal effects and several seasons of historical data. Prophet is robust to missing data and shifts in the trend, and typically handles outliers well.

genieclust:Fast and Robust Hierarchical Clustering with Noise Points Detection
A retake on the Genie algorithm (Gagolewski, 2021 <DOI:10.1016/j.softx.2021.100722>), which is a robust hierarchical clustering method (Gagolewski, Bartoszuk, Cena, 2016 <DOI:10.1016/j.ins.2016.05.003>). It is now faster and more memory efficient; determining the whole cluster hierarchy for datasets of 10M points in low dimensional Euclidean spaces or 100K points in high-dimensional ones takes only a minute or so. Allows clustering with respect to mutual reachability distances so that it can act as a noise point detector or a robustified version of 'HDBSCAN*' (that is able to detect a predefined number of clusters and hence it does not dependent on the somewhat fragile 'eps' parameter). The package also features an implementation of inequality indices (e.g., Gini and Bonferroni), external cluster validity measures (e.g., the normalised clustering accuracy, the adjusted Rand index, the Fowlkes-Mallows index, and normalised mutual information), and internal cluster validity indices (e.g., the Calinski-Harabasz, Davies-Bouldin, Ball-Hall, Silhouette, and generalised Dunn indices). See also the 'Python' version of 'genieclust' available on 'PyPI', which supports sparse data, more metrics, and even larger datasets.

AdhereR:Adherence to Medications
Computation of adherence to medications from Electronic Health care Data and visualization of individual medication histories and adherence patterns. The package implements a set of S3 classes and functions consistent with current adherence guidelines and definitions. It allows the computation of different measures of adherence (as defined in the literature, but also several original ones), their publication-quality plotting, the estimation of event duration and time to initiation, the interactive exploration of patient medication history and the real-time estimation of adherence given various parameter settings. It scales from very small datasets stored in flat CSV files to very large databases and from single-thread processing on mid-range consumer laptops to parallel processing on large heterogeneous computing clusters. It exposes a standardized interface allowing it to be used from other programming languages and platforms, such as Python.

rosettaPTF:R Frontend for Rosetta Pedotransfer Functions
Access Python rosetta-soil pedotransfer functions in an R environment. Rosetta is a neural network-based model for predicting unsaturated soil hydraulic parameters from basic soil characterization data. The model predicts parameters for the van Genuchten unsaturated soil hydraulic properties model, using sand, silt, and clay, bulk density and water content. The codebase is now maintained by Dr. Todd Skaggs and other U.S. Department of Agriculture employees. This R package is intended to provide for use cases that involve many thousands of calls to the pedotransfer function. Less demanding use cases are encouraged to use the web interface or API endpoint. There are additional wrappers of the API endpoints provided by the soilDB R package `ROSETTA()` method.
